匠心精神 - 良心品质腾讯认可的专业机构-IT人的高薪实战学院

咨询电话:4000806560

【Python基础入门】Python数据类型详解,快速上手基础编程!

【Python基础入门】Python数据类型详解,快速上手基础编程!

Python是一种高级编程语言,是许多程序员入门的首选。Python是一种面向对象的动态类型语言,它的特点使得它很容易学习和使用。在本文中,我们将介绍Python的数据类型,帮助初学者更好地理解Python的基础编程。

一. 数字类型

Python支持各种类型的数字数据。最常见的数字类型包括整数、浮点数和复数。

整数:Python中的整数类型是int。Python可以使用整数进行基本的算术运算,如加法、减法、乘法和除法。Python的整数可以是任意位数的,不受内存限制。

浮点数:Python中的浮点数类型是float。浮点数是带有小数点的数字。Python中的浮点数可以进行基本的算术运算,如加法、减法、乘法和除法。但是需要注意的是浮点数在计算机中的表示是有限的,因此在进行比较时需要特别小心。

复数:Python中的复数类型是complex。复数是由实数和虚数组成的数字,形式为a+bj,其中a和b是实数,j是虚数单位。Python中的复数可以进行基本的算术运算。

二. 布尔类型

Python中的布尔类型是bool。布尔类型只有两个值,True和False。布尔类型通常用于逻辑运算,例如在条件语句中使用。

三. 字符串类型

Python中的字符串类型是str。字符串是由零个或多个字符组成的序列。Python中的字符串可以使用单引号或双引号进行定义。字符串可以进行拼接、分割和索引等操作。

拼接:可以使用“+”操作符将两个字符串拼接在一起。

分割:可以使用split()方法将一个字符串分割成一个列表。

索引:可以使用中括号访问一个字符串中的单个字符。

四. 列表类型

Python中的列表类型是list。列表是一个有序的集合,其中每个元素可以是任何类型的数据,包括数字、字符串和其他列表。Python中的列表可以进行添加、删除、排序和索引等操作。

添加:可以使用append()方法将一个元素添加到列表的末尾。

删除:可以使用del语句或remove()方法将一个元素从列表中删除。

排序:可以使用sort()方法将列表中的元素排序。

索引:可以使用中括号访问列表中的单个元素。

五. 元组类型

Python中的元组类型是tuple。元组是一个有序的集合,其中每个元素可以是任何类型的数据,包括数字、字符串和其他元组。与列表不同的是,元组是不可更改的,也就是说,一旦元组创建后,就不能添加、删除或改变其中的元素。

六. 字典类型

Python中的字典类型是dict。字典是一个键值对的集合,其中每个键对应一个值。字典是无序的,但是可以使用键来访问相应的值。Python中的字典可以进行添加、删除和修改等操作。

添加:可以使用update()方法将一个键值对添加到字典中。

删除:可以使用del语句或pop()方法将一个键值对从字典中删除。

修改:可以使用中括号访问一个键的值,并使用赋值语句来修改该值。

七. 集合类型

Python中的集合类型是set。集合是一个无序的集合,其中每个元素必须是唯一的。Python中的集合可以进行添加、删除和交并等操作。

添加:可以使用add()方法将一个元素添加到集合中。

删除:可以使用remove()方法将一个元素从集合中删除。

交并:可以使用intersection()和union()方法来计算两个集合的交集和并集。

总结:

本文介绍了Python中的常见数据类型,包括数字类型、布尔类型、字符串类型、列表类型、元组类型、字典类型和集合类型。对于初学者来说,掌握这些数据类型非常重要,能够让他们更加轻松地编写Python程序。